Indian Vampire movie poster

Indian Vampire

"The first Italian western film ever made"

December 1, 1913 0h 30m

Originally released in 1913. Indian Vampire is a western/drama film. directed by Roberto Roberti. At just 30 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.

Starring Antonietta Calderari, Frederico Elvezi, and Antonio Greco

Synopsis

Considered the first spaghetti-western ever. The director Roberto Roberti being the father of Sergio Leone along with member of the cast Bice Valerian, wife of the director and mother of Sergio Leone.
